Planner plans owned by Teams
LeonPavesic yes i know, but if you create a planner within a Teams/Office 365 group context the planner plan will be owned by that group and not by that user.. and each group can own 200 planner plan, ,regardless if the group creator owns other planner plans or not.. did you get my question/point?
Hi johnjohn-Peter,
I understand your point.
If a user creates a Planner plan within the context of a Teams/Office 365 group, the ownership is associated with that group, and each group can own up to 200 Planner plans, independent of the plans owned by the individual user who created the group.
So, to clarify, if a user is a member of multiple Teams or owns many Teams, the Planner plan limit is still 200 plans per group, not per individual user. Creating additional Teams doesn't provide a way to surpass the 200 Planner plans limit for a specific group. The limit is enforced at the group level, regardless of the user's ownership or membership across different groups.
